6 cans of fruit juice cost $2.50. Ned needs to buy 72 cans for a camping trip for the Outdoor Club how much will he spend​

Answer:

$30

Step-by-step explanation:

Let 6 cans represent an "order" of fruit juice. 72 cans means 12 orders (72 divided by 6). Since each order costs $2.50, 12 orders costs $30 (12 multiplied by 2.5).
